Am I allowed to use medical cannabis in Norway?
Only on prescription — medical cannabis is allowed through two routes, but not for free use. One is approved medicines such as Sativex (MS spasms) and Epidyolex (severe epilepsy), which can be prescribed. The other is a special exemption from the Medical Products Agency (DMP) for unregistered cannabis products, where the doctor applies. It is a last resort: you must first have tried approved alternatives without sufficient effect. Ordinary (recreational) cannabis is still illegal, and you cannot grow cannabis yourself, not even with a prescription. Exemption products are usually paid privately.

🔓 Exceptions
- MS and severe epilepsy patients can get approved medicines on hospital prescription
- A specialist can start treatment for chronic pain when standard treatment has failed
- Hospitals can initiate and administer in defined cases
⚠️ Penalties & fines
Cannabis outside the medical route is illegal under the Medicines Act and Penal Code. Possession, use and especially home cultivation are punishable by a fine or prison depending on quantity.
